LINCOLN MORTGAGE & T. GUAR. CO. v. COMMISSIONER INT. REV.

No. 5685.

79 F.2d 585 (1935)

LINCOLN MORTGAGE & TITLE GUARANTY CO. et al. v. COMMISSIONER OF INTERNAL REVENUE.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Third Circuit.

September 24, 1935.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Merritt Lane and Bilder, Bilder & Kaufman, all of Newark, N. J. (Merritt Lane and Samuel Kaufman, both of Newark, N. J., and Louis Spiegler, of Washington, D. C., of counsel; Morris M. Schnitzer, of Newark, N. J., on the brief), for petitioners.

Frank J. Wideman, Asst. Atty. Gen., and Sewall Key and Morton K. Rothschild, Sp. Assts. to Atty. Gen., for respondent.

Before BUFFINGTON, DAVIS, and THOMPSON, Circuit Judges.


DAVIS, Circuit Judge.

This appeal involves the liability of the taxpayer, the Lincoln Mortgage & Title Guaranty Company, for income taxes for the years 1926 and 1927.

The taxpayer was incorporated under the insurance laws of the state of New Jersey and was operated under the direction and supervision of the department of banking and insurance of that state.
